Apple has discontinued the iPod, 20 years after it was released.

The US tech giant stated its iconic music player has been changed by other gadgets, making the iPod redundant.

Greg Joswiak, Apple's senior vice-president of worldwide advertising, mentioned: "Immediately, the spirit of iPod lives on.

"We've built-in an unbelievable music experience across all of our merchandise, from the iPhone to the Apple Watch to HomePod mini, and throughout Mac, iPad, and Apple TV.

"And Apple Music delivers industry-leading sound quality with assist for spatial audio - there's no better strategy to take pleasure in, discover, and experience music."

In October 2001, Steve Jobs debuted the original iPod and it was the first MP3 participant that could maintain 1,000 songs and had a 10-hour battery life.

"With iPod, Apple has invented an entire new class of digital music player that permits you to put your complete music assortment in your pocket and hearken to it wherever you go," he mentioned at the time.

"With iPod, listening to music will never be the identical once more."

Comparable MP3 gamers released by Microsoft and Sony didn't have the same success because the iPod.

Apple has launched 5 variations of its music participant - the Classic, Touch, Shuffle, Mini and Nano.

The corporate has been slowly killing its iPod range in recent times, with mobile phone technology enabling clients to hearken to music services on their telephones.

In 2014, the basic click wheel model was discontinued, and the Shuffle and Nano had been killed off three years later.

The seventh-generation iPod touch was the one mannequin still on sale at the moment.

With out the iPod, there would never have been an iPhone or iPod, according to its inventor Tony Fadell.
